Step 2: Creating a Sell Order

  1. Log in to your exchange account.
  2. Navigate to "Trade" > "Sell".
  3. Select the SHIB trading pair (e.g., SHIB/USDT).
  4. Enter the amount of SHIB to sell.
  5. Choose an order type:

    • Limit Order: Set a specific price.
    • Market Order: Sell instantly at current market rates.

Step 4: Transferring SHIB to Another Wallet

  1. After sale completion, go to "Withdraw".
  2. Select SHIB, enter the recipient’s wallet address and amount.
  3. Review and confirm.

FAQs

1. How long does a SHIB sell order take to process?

Market orders execute instantly; limit orders depend on price matching.

2. What’s the best exchange to sell SHIB?

Top platforms include Binance, OKX, and Coinbase.

3. Can I cancel a SHIB sell order?

Yes, pending orders can usually be canceled in your exchange’s "Open Orders" section.

4. Why did SHIB’s price drop recently?

Due to market-wide declines and low investor confidence in meme coins.

5. How secure are SHIB transactions?

Ensure 2FA is enabled and use verified wallet addresses.
